I am attempting to turn a sage project “CompGIT” into an 
optional/experimental sage package, with the long-term goal of becoming a 
standard package. 

CompGIT computes GIT quotients, a useful tool for algebraic geometers, for 
which no sage implementation is currently available. A preliminary version 
of the project is available at https://github.com/Robbie-H/CompGIT

As a first-time developer, I am looking for guidance on the prerequisites, 
best practise for presenting the code, and how to engage with the sage 
package peer review process. I am aware of the procedure outlined by sage 
at 
https://doc.sagemath.org/html/en/developer/packaging.html#section-inclusion-procedure,
 
any additional advice would be appreciated.
